# Benchmarking scripts This directory contains benchmarking scripts and reproducing steps. ## COHERE experiments ### Getting COHERE Data Please download the COHERE 10M dataset to cohere_large_10m as follows: ```bash neighbors_head_1p.parquet neighbors_tail_1pgit.parquet neighbors_labels_label_20p.parquet neighbors_labels_label_50p.parquet neighbors_labels_label_80p.parquet neighbors_labels_label_95p.parquet neighbors.parquet shuffle_train-00-of-10.parquet shuffle_train-01-of-10.parquet shuffle_train-02-of-10.parquet shuffle_train-03-of-10.parquet shuffle_train-04-of-10.parquet shuffle_train-05-of-10.parquet shuffle_train-06-of-10.parquet shuffle_train-07-of-10.parquet shuffle_train-08-of-10.parquet shuffle_train-09-of-10.parquet scalar_labels.parquet test.parquet ``` ### Preparing Environment Clone code and init: ```bash $ git clone git@github.com:alibaba/zvec.git $ cd zvec $ git submodule update --init ``` Make build docker image: ```bash docker build -t zvec/build-image:latest -f ./.github/workflows/docker/Dockerfile.ubuntu18.10-glibc228 . ``` Start bulld container: ```bash docker run -it --net=host -d -e DEBUG_MODE=true --user root --cap-add=SYS_PTRACE --security-opt seccomp=unconfined -v /home/zvec/:/home/zvec/ -w /home/zvec --name=build_zvec zvec/build-image:latest bash ``` Turn-off complation option: ``` option(BUILD_PYTHON_BINDINGS "Build Python bindings using pybind11" ON) => option(BUILD_PYTHON_BINDINGS "Build Python bindings using pybind11" OFF) ``` Build source code: ``` $ docker exec -it build_zvec bash $ cd /home/zvec/workspace/zvec $ mkdir build $ cd build $ cmake -DENABLE_SKYLAKE=ON -DCMAKE_BUILD_TYPE=Release .. ``` ### Converting Dataset Export vector data using python script: ```bash $ mkdir 10m.output $ python3 convert_cohere_parquet.py ``` Convert vector data to binary formatted file. ```bash /home/zvec/workspace/zvec/bin/txt2vecs -input=cohere_train_vector_10m.txt --output=cohere_train_vector_10m.zvec.vecs --dimension=768 ``` ### Preparing Bench Config Prepare Build Config ```yaml BuilderCommon: BuilderClass: HnswStreamer BuildFile: /home/zvec/bench/data/10m/cohere_train_vector_10m.zvec.vecs NeedTrain: true TrainFile: /home/zvec/bench/data/10m/cohere_train_vector_10m.zvec.vecs DumpPath: /home/zvec/bench/config/cohere_train_vector_10m.index IndexPath: /home/zvec/bench/config/cohere_train_vector_10m.2.index ConverterName: CosineInt8Converter MetricName: Cosine ThreadCount: 16 BuilderParams: proxima.general.builder.thread_count: !!int 16 proxima.hnsw.builder.thread_count: !!int 16 ``` Prepare Search Config ```yaml SearcherCommon: SearcherClass: HnswStreamer IndexPath: /home/zvec/bench/config/cohere_train_vector_10m.2.index TopK: 1,10,50,100 QueryFile: /home/zvec/bench/data/10m/cohere_test_vector_1000.new.txt QueryType: float QueryFirstSep: ";" QuerySecondSep: " " GroundTruthFile: /home/zvec/bench/data/10m/neighbors.txt RecallThreadCount: 1 BenchThreadCount: 16 BenchIterCount: 1000000000 CompareById: true SearcherParams: proxima.hnsw.streamer.ef: !!int 250 ``` ### Building Index Conduct Build ```bash $ /home/zvec/workspace/zvec/build/bin/local_build_original ./build.yaml ``` ### Performing Bench Conduct Recall ```bash $ /home/zvec/workspace/zvec/build/bin/recall_original ./search.yaml ``` Conduct Bench ```bash $ /home/zvec/workspace/zvec/build/bin/bench_original ./search.yaml ```
